The Roskilde Festival, one of Europe’s most celebrated cultural gatherings, is set to return to Roskilde, Denmark, from June 27 to July 4, 2026. With its roots deeply embedded in music, creativity, and community spirit, this event is poised to attract a vibrant crowd of over 130,000 attendees from across the globe. What to Expect at Roskilde 2026

Roskilde Festival is not just about music; it’s a fusion of art, culture, and social activism. The festival spans eight days, offering a mix of top-tier music performances, inspiring talks, art exhibitions, and immersive cultural experiences. It brings together international and local artists across multiple genres, ensuring a diverse and dynamic atmosphere. The festival has consistently ranked among the top music events in Europe and has been a platform for groundbreaking performances for decades.

The Music Lineup:
In 2026, festival-goers can expect an eclectic mix of rock, electronic, hip-hop, indie, and world music acts. With more than 180 performances across seven main stages, the Roskilde lineup attracts established acts as well as emerging artists, creating a space for all genres to thrive. From mainstream legends to underground heroes, the event is designed to satisfy the tastes of every music fan.

Cultural and Artistic Experiences:
Beyond the music, the festival is known for its rich cultural programming. Art installations, theatrical performances, and workshops will be scattered across the site, ensuring that attendees are immersed in a multi-sensory environment. The festival also highlights important social and environmental causes, with various initiatives that encourage sustainability, inclusivity, and community participation.

The Heart of the Festival: Camping and Community

For many, camping at Roskilde Festival is as iconic as the music itself. Thousands of attendees set up camp around the festival site, transforming it into a temporary village. Camping at Roskilde is an immersive experience that fosters a sense of community. The festival offers a variety of camping options, from general campsites to special areas for those seeking a quieter experience.

The volunteer camping zones offer slightly better amenities, while the community camping areas allow fans to camp together with others who share similar interests. For those looking for more comfort, the VIP or reserved camping areas provide additional amenities, such as hot showers and access to rest zones.

Tickets: Accessing the Heart of Roskilde Festival

Tickets for Roskilde Festival 2026 are available in different tiers to accommodate various needs and budgets. Full festival tickets, which grant access to all eight days, are priced at 2,600 DKK (approximately €350–€450). For those who prefer more flexibility, two-day tickets or one-day passes are available at lower prices. These options provide festival-goers the freedom to explore the festival’s offerings, whether for the entire event or just a part of it.

The festival’s non-profit structure ensures that proceeds are reinvested into charitable causes, making every ticket purchase a contribution to the wider community. The festival also offers discounted tickets for those under 18, further promoting inclusivity and making it accessible to younger generations.

Getting to Roskilde Festival: Easy Access from Copenhagen

Roskilde is located just 30 kilometers from Copenhagen, making it easily accessible via public transport. Regular train services from Copenhagen Central Station run to Roskilde and take around 30–40 minutes. The festival has a special transport network, ensuring that the journey to and from the event is as smooth as possible.

For those arriving from outside Denmark, Copenhagen Airport offers direct connections to major European cities, making it an ideal gateway for international travelers heading to Roskilde. From Copenhagen, visitors can take a short train ride to Roskilde or use shuttle buses that run during the festival period.

The Roskilde Spirit: Community and Social Impact

Roskilde Festival stands out for its commitment to social causes and its focus on creating a positive impact. As a non-profit event, the festival’s mission goes beyond entertainment. Each year, a significant portion of the profits is directed towards cultural projects, humanitarian initiatives, and environmental causes. This ethos of giving back has contributed to the festival’s lasting legacy as a cultural institution in Denmark.

Visitors to Roskilde are not only attending a music event but also participating in a community-driven experience. The festival fosters an environment of acceptance, inclusivity, and collaboration, with an emphasis on breaking down barriers and creating connections between individuals from all walks of life.
